Pablo Rivera Jr., age 22, of Philadelphia, died suddenly on December 30, 2025. He was the beloved son of Pablo Sr. and Gloria and cherished brother of Alex, Anthony, Angelica, Raphael, Stephanie, and Ashley. You were just stepping into adulthood, with so much life ahead of you. A loving son, brother, and uncle who would give anything to help others. You did not deserve this. You were deeply loved by so many, more than words could ever express. Until we meet again — we will see each other later. Rest in peace, Pablo Rivera Jr.
A fun-loving and generous young man, Pablo enjoyed motorcycles, cars, and spending time with his friends. He came from a big, loving family and leaves behind many relatives who will miss him deeply. Pablo touched countless lives and will be missed by his community. He attended Word of Grace Church in Wissinoming and was known for his love of candy—he always had some in his pocket to share. His final act of kindness was saving lives through organ donation through Gift of Life.
A service to honor his life will be held on Monday January 12th at 11 am with his viewing beginning 9 AM at McCafferty Sweeney Slabinski Barnes funerals and cremations 2614 Orthodox Street. Burial will follow in Cedar Hill Cemetery.
